In today’s digital age, website performance plays a crucial role in attracting and retaining users. One of the key factors that determine website performance is Core Web Vitals. Core Web Vitals are a set of metrics introduced by Google to measure the user experience of a website. These metrics include Largest Contentful Paint (LCP), First Input Delay (FID), and Cumulative Layout Shift (CLS). Optimizing Core Web Vitals is essential for improving website performance and ensuring a positive user experience.
Summary
- Core Web Vitals are essential for optimizing website performance and improving user experience.
- Understanding user experience and SEO is crucial for optimizing Core Web Vitals.
- Measuring Core Web Vitals is necessary to identify areas for improvement.
- Tips for improving Core Web Vitals include optimizing images, reducing server response time, and minimizing JavaScript and CSS.
- Optimizing Core Web Vitals can lead to increased user engagement and improved SEO rankings.
Understanding User Experience and SEO
User experience (UX) and search engine optimization (SEO) are closely intertwined. A good user experience leads to higher user engagement, longer time spent on the website, and lower bounce rates. All these factors contribute to better SEO rankings. On the other hand, if a website has poor user experience, users are more likely to leave the site quickly, resulting in higher bounce rates and lower rankings on search engine result pages (SERPs).
Core Web Vitals have a direct impact on user experience and SEO. When a website loads quickly, responds promptly to user interactions, and maintains visual stability, it provides a positive user experience. This leads to increased user engagement and improved SEO rankings. Conversely, if a website has slow loading times, delayed response to user interactions, or elements that shift unexpectedly, it creates a negative user experience, resulting in lower user engagement and decreased SEO rankings.
Importance of Core Web Vitals for Website Performance
Core Web Vitals play a crucial role in determining the overall performance of a website. Each metric measures a different aspect of the user experience:
1. Largest Contentful Paint (LCP): LCP measures how quickly the largest content element on a webpage loads. It indicates how fast users can see the main content of a page. A good LCP score is crucial for providing a fast-loading experience to users.
2. First Input Delay (FID): FID measures the time it takes for a webpage to respond to the first user interaction, such as clicking a button or selecting a menu item. A low FID score indicates that the website is responsive and provides a smooth user experience.
3. Cumulative Layout Shift (CLS): CLS measures the visual stability of a webpage. It quantifies how much the layout of a page shifts during the loading process. A low CLS score ensures that users can interact with the website without elements moving unexpectedly, which enhances the overall user experience.
Website owners should prioritize Core Web Vitals optimization because they directly impact user experience and website performance. By optimizing these metrics, website owners can ensure that their websites load quickly, respond promptly to user interactions, and maintain visual stability. This leads to improved user engagement, lower bounce rates, and higher SEO rankings.
How to Measure Core Web Vitals
Core Web Vital | Metric | Ideal Value | Good Value | Needs Improvement Value |
---|---|---|---|---|
Loading | First Contentful Paint (FCP) | Less than 2.5 seconds | 2.5 – 4 seconds | More than 4 seconds |
Largest Contentful Paint (LCP) | Less than 2.5 seconds | 2.5 – 4 seconds | More than 4 seconds | |
Cumulative Layout Shift (CLS) | Less than 0.1 | 0.1 – 0.25 | More than 0.25 | |
Interactivity | First Input Delay (FID) | Less than 100 milliseconds | 100 – 300 milliseconds | More than 300 milliseconds |
Total Blocking Time (TBT) | Less than 300 milliseconds | 300 – 600 milliseconds | More than 600 milliseconds |
To measure Core Web Vitals, website owners can use various tools provided by Google and other third-party providers. These tools analyze the performance of a website and provide insights into its Core Web Vitals metrics. Some popular tools for measuring Core Web Vitals include:
1. Google PageSpeed Insights: This tool analyzes the performance of a webpage and provides a score for both mobile and desktop devices. It also provides detailed information about the Core Web Vitals metrics and suggestions for improvement.
2. Google Search Console: This tool allows website owners to monitor their website’s performance in search results. It provides data on Core Web Vitals metrics and alerts website owners if there are any issues that need to be addressed.
3. Lighthouse: Lighthouse is an open-source tool developed by Google that audits webpages for performance, accessibility, SEO, and more. It provides detailed reports on Core Web Vitals metrics and offers suggestions for improvement.
Interpreting Core Web Vitals data is essential for understanding the performance of a website and identifying areas for improvement. Website owners should pay attention to the scores and recommendations provided by these tools to optimize their Core Web Vitals effectively.
Tips for Improving Core Web Vitals
Optimizing Core Web Vitals requires implementing best practices that improve website performance. Here are some tips for improving each Core Web Vitals metric:
1. Largest Contentful Paint (LCP):
– Optimize server response times by using a fast hosting provider and implementing caching techniques.
– Compress and optimize images to reduce their file size.
– Minimize render-blocking resources by deferring or asynchronously loading JavaScript and CSS files.
2. First Input Delay (FID):
– Minimize JavaScript execution time by removing unnecessary code and optimizing critical rendering path.
– Use browser caching to reduce the time it takes to load JavaScript files.
– Prioritize visible content by loading critical resources first.
3. Cumulative Layout Shift (CLS):
– Set explicit dimensions for images, videos, and other media elements to prevent layout shifts.
– Avoid inserting new content above existing content, as it can cause unexpected layout shifts.
– Use CSS animations and transitions with care to prevent layout shifts.
By following these best practices, website owners can improve their Core Web Vitals metrics and provide a better user experience.
Impact of Core Web Vitals on User Engagement
Core Web Vitals have a significant impact on user engagement. When a website loads quickly, responds promptly to user interactions, and maintains visual stability, users are more likely to stay on the site, explore its content, and interact with its features. This leads to increased user engagement, longer time spent on the website, and lower bounce rates.
Several websites have successfully improved user engagement through Core Web Vitals optimization. For example, a popular e-commerce website implemented various performance optimizations to improve its LCP, FID, and CLS scores. As a result, the website’s bounce rate decreased by 20%, and the average time spent on the site increased by 15%. These improvements in user engagement also led to higher conversion rates and increased revenue for the website.
Benefits of Optimizing Core Web Vitals for SEO
Optimizing Core Web Vitals not only improves user experience but also has several benefits for SEO. When a website provides a fast-loading experience, responds promptly to user interactions, and maintains visual stability, it leads to higher user engagement and lower bounce rates. These factors contribute to better SEO rankings.
Google has also announced that starting from May 2021, Core Web Vitals will be included as ranking signals in its search algorithm. This means that websites with better Core Web Vitals metrics are more likely to rank higher in search results. By optimizing Core Web Vitals, website owners can improve their SEO rankings and attract more organic traffic to their websites.
Common Mistakes to Avoid in Core Web Vitals Optimization
When optimizing Core Web Vitals, website owners should be aware of common mistakes that can negatively impact their efforts. Some common mistakes to avoid include:
1. Ignoring mobile performance: With the increasing use of mobile devices, it is essential to optimize Core Web Vitals for mobile users. Ignoring mobile performance can lead to poor user experience and lower SEO rankings.
2. Overloading the website with unnecessary scripts and plugins: Excessive use of scripts and plugins can slow down a website and negatively impact Core Web Vitals metrics. Website owners should regularly review and remove unnecessary scripts and plugins to improve performance.
3. Neglecting image optimization: Large image files can significantly impact LCP and overall website performance. Website owners should optimize images by compressing them without compromising quality.
To avoid these mistakes, website owners should regularly monitor their Core Web Vitals metrics, implement best practices, and make necessary optimizations.
Best Practices for Core Web Vitals Optimization
To optimize Core Web Vitals effectively, website owners should follow best practices that improve website performance. Here are some best practices for optimizing each Core Web Vitals metric:
1. Largest Contentful Paint (LCP):
– Optimize server response times by using a fast hosting provider and implementing caching techniques.
– Compress and optimize images to reduce their file size.
– Minimize render-blocking resources by deferring or asynchronously loading JavaScript and CSS files.
2. First Input Delay (FID):
– Minimize JavaScript execution time by removing unnecessary code and optimizing critical rendering path.
– Use browser caching to reduce the time it takes to load JavaScript files.
– Prioritize visible content by loading critical resources first.
3. Cumulative Layout Shift (CLS):
– Set explicit dimensions for images, videos, and other media elements to prevent layout shifts.
– Avoid inserting new content above existing content, as it can cause unexpected layout shifts.
– Use CSS animations and transitions with care to prevent layout shifts.
By implementing these best practices, website owners can optimize their Core Web Vitals metrics and provide a better user experience.
Enhancing User Experience and SEO with Core Web Vitals Optimization
In conclusion, optimizing Core Web Vitals is crucial for improving website performance, enhancing user experience, and boosting SEO rankings. Core Web Vitals metrics directly impact user engagement, bounce rates, and time spent on a website. By measuring and interpreting these metrics, website owners can identify areas for improvement and implement best practices to optimize their Core Web Vitals effectively.
Optimizing Core Web Vitals not only improves user experience but also has several benefits for SEO. Websites with better Core Web Vitals metrics are more likely to rank higher in search results, attracting more organic traffic. By avoiding common mistakes and following best practices, website owners can enhance user experience, increase user engagement, and improve their SEO rankings. Prioritizing Core Web Vitals optimization is essential for staying competitive in the digital landscape and providing a seamless browsing experience for users.
If you’re interested in improving your web development skills and staying up to date with the latest trends, you might find this article on “Mastering the Art of Web Development: Tips and Tricks for Success” helpful. It provides valuable insights and practical advice for web developers looking to enhance their expertise. From coding techniques to project management tips, this comprehensive guide covers various aspects of web development. Check it out here.
FAQs
What are Core Web Vitals?
Core Web Vitals are a set of metrics that measure the loading speed, interactivity, and visual stability of a website. These metrics include Largest Contentful Paint (LCP), First Input Delay (FID), and Cumulative Layout Shift (CLS).
Why are Core Web Vitals important?
Core Web Vitals are important because they directly impact user experience. Websites that load quickly, respond to user input promptly, and don’t shift around as they load are more likely to keep users engaged and satisfied. Additionally, Google has announced that Core Web Vitals will become a ranking factor in its search algorithm starting in May 2021.
How can I optimize for Core Web Vitals?
There are several steps you can take to optimize for Core Web Vitals, including optimizing images and videos, reducing server response times, minimizing JavaScript and CSS, and using a content delivery network (CDN). You can also use tools like Google’s PageSpeed Insights and Lighthouse to identify areas for improvement.
What is Largest Contentful Paint (LCP)?
Largest Contentful Paint (LCP) measures the loading speed of a website by tracking the time it takes for the largest element on the page to become visible. This element is typically an image or a block of text.
What is First Input Delay (FID)?
First Input Delay (FID) measures the responsiveness of a website by tracking the time it takes for the website to respond to a user’s first interaction, such as clicking a button or entering text into a form.
What is Cumulative Layout Shift (CLS)?
Cumulative Layout Shift (CLS) measures the visual stability of a website by tracking the amount of unexpected layout shifts that occur as the page loads. These shifts can be caused by images or ads loading after the rest of the page, or by elements moving around as the page loads.